From time to time I get asked advice regarding issues of 'Health and Safety' where the outlook of the volunteer/worker is at variance with others in the church.

I usually find the enquirer occupies a sensible position of managing and reducing risk; whilst creating good youth work opportunity and experience.

The tensions though come from two different ends of the safety continuum. Some volunteers/workers find that they are being seen as over-the-top as there is an inherent laissez-faire attitude. Others find that they get it in the neck for allowing anything other than a supervised stroll around the church hall (and then the inside thereof)

I don't know why I started scribbling this other than I was musing that ploughing the correct course risked criticism from two completely different stances.
